Forester's wife and son arrested for his murder in Nayagarh

Bhubaneswar, June 2: Police have arrested the wife and son of forester Sishir Sahu, whose half-burnt body was recovered from his residence in Baramasidanda area of Nayagarh town, Odisha, on Saturday.
Sahu, posted at the Sarankul Pancharida forest range, was allegedly set ablaze by his wife Namita and son Abhisek following a heated argument on Friday night. According to Nayagarh SDPO Jyoti Ranjan Samantaray, a crime scene reconstruction and interrogation led to their arrest. Namita reportedly suffered minor burn injuries during the incident, while Abhisek remained unhurt.
“Both the wife and son confessed to the crime. Family disputes appear to be the motive,” the SDPO stated. Sahu was said to rarely visit home and often slept in his vehicle during visits.
Investigators initially suspected the murder was pre-planned and attempted to be staged as an accident, possibly linked to suspicions of Sahu’s extramarital affair. Evidence, including widespread fire damage throughout the house, indicated petrol was poured extensively to ensure his death.
